Back links, what are they? Back links are defined as links that are pointed towards your web page. Back links are also referred to as Inbound Links or simply IBLs. Remember that in a particular site, the number of back links is an indication of how popular or how important that website is. 1 way back links are vital for the scope of Search Engine Optimization, because with some Search Engine, Google for instance, gives more attention to websites that have a good number of quality back links, not the quality of website design. These search engines tend to consider these sites more relevant compared to the others in their result pages when you do a search query.
When search engines such as Google or Yahoo analyze the relevance of a particular website to a given keyword, they put into consideration the number of quality inbound links to that particular website. So our real target is not only just with simply getting inbound links but to get back links that are of good quality because this is what matters most. To determine the quality of a back link, the search engines analyze the quality of a site’s content. When a back link found in your site have originated from other websites what contain a related content, these back links are considered to be more relevant compared to your website. However, if a back links are found on sites with unrelated contents with your website, they are being considered as less relevant. So, we can all agree that the higher the relevance of a back link, the quality is greater and more web traffic is brought in.
For example, if a webmaster creates a website that deals about how to rescue orphaned kittens, and was given an inbound link from another site dealing with the topic kittens, then that would be more relevant in the analysis of a search engine assessment than let’s say for example a back link from a site dealing with the topic about health issues. Remember that a good back link quality would require a more related website linking back to your website.
